Epic Games proposes Google app store reforms after antitrust win
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
Epic Games has asked a judge to require Google to make modifications to its Play Store after accusing the tech giant of abusing its power over Android mobile apps. The request was made following an antitrust trial last year, which ended with a jury ruling against Google. Epic Games has submitted its proposal to U.S. District Judge James Donato in San Francisco.

Another Google antitrust battle reaches court in Epic Games case
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
Google is facing another legal battle as Epic Games takes the company to court over an antitrust lawsuit. Epic Games claims that Google is violating antitrust laws by using its dominant power over app developers on the Google Play Store. The game developer had tried to circumvent the Play Store's fees by allowing direct in-app purchases, prompting Google to remove Fortnite from the store. If Epic Games is successful, Google could be forced to change its Play Store rules and allow competing app stores. These lawsuits add to the challenges Google faces as regulators and competitors target its influence in the tech industry.

Alphabet, Tinder-owner Match settle Google Play antitrust claims before US trial
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
Google has settled with Match Group, the owner of dating app Tinder, in a claim that it monopolized Android app distribution through its Play Store. Epic Games is now the sole plaintiff in the antitrust trial against Google, set to begin on November 6th. Match Group has stated that it reached a partnership agreement with Google, while Epic Games will proceed to trial against Google alone. Both Epic Games and Match Group accused Google of unlawfully maintaining a monopoly in the distribution of Android apps.

Apple reverses course and clears way for Epic Games to set up rival iPhone app store in Europe
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
Apple has allowed Epic Games, the maker of Fortnite, to establish an alternative app store for iPhone apps in Europe. This decision comes after a legal battle between Apple and Epic Games over app distribution and fees for in-app transactions. Apple had originally rejected Epic's attempt to create an alternative store, but new regulations in the European Union cleared the way for competition against Apple's App Store. The feud between the two companies is ongoing, with Apple demanding over $73 million from Epic Games to cover its fees in a US antitrust case.

Google defends app store, fighting Epic Games' bid for major reforms
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
Google is opposing the proposed changes to its app store, Play, in the ongoing antitrust battle with Epic Games. Epic Games wants Google to make it easier for users to download apps from other sources and allow more flexibility for developers in offering and charging for purchases. Google argues that these changes would harm privacy, security, and overall user experience. Google claims that the remedies proposed in a related settlement with states and consumers adequately address the alleged anticompetitive conduct presented by Epic Games. This comes as Google also faces an antitrust case regarding its dominance in mobile web search.

Google asks judge to overturn Epic Games antitrust verdict
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
Google has requested a judge to reject the jury verdict in the antitrust lawsuit filed by Epic Games, the maker of "Fortnite." The jury had found that Google abused its dominance in the app store market. Google argues that Epic Games did not provide sufficient evidence to support the verdict and that it competes with Apple in the mobile apps space. Epic Games is expected to seek specific changes to Google's Play store based on the verdict. Google settled related claims for $700 million before the trial and has the option to appeal the December verdict.

Google antitrust trial focused on Android app store payments to be handed off to jury to decide
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
The article is about the antitrust trial between Google and Epic Games, focusing on Google's app store for Android smartphones. The trial, which has been ongoing for four weeks, centers on allegations that Google's payment system within its Play Store is exploiting consumers and stifling innovation. Epic Games claims that Google's commissions, similar to Apple's, create a monopoly, while Google argues that it operates in a competitive market. The jury's verdict will depend on how the smartphone app market is defined.

Apple reverses decision to ban Epic Games from having its own app store
Business Insider
·
1y ago
Medial
Apple has reversed its decision to not allow Epic Games to have its own app store on iOS in Europe. This comes after the European Union threatened to investigate the ban. Epic Games, the creator of Fortnite, has been fighting against Apple and Google's control over in-app purchases. The European Commission's implementation of the Digital Markets Act further supports the need for competition in the app store industry. Apple reinstated Epic Games' account and agreed to new EU-focused policies. Epic Games also has an ongoing lawsuit against Google regarding the Google Play store's payment system.

Google loses appeal over app store reforms in Epic Games case - The Economic Times
Economic Times
·
6d ago
Medial
In a US appeals case, Google failed to overturn a ruling requiring changes to its Play Store operations due to antitrust claims by Epic Games, which accused Google of monopolistic practices. The 9th US Circuit Court upheld a jury's decision favoring Epic, emphasizing fair competition. Epic argued Google's conduct harmed the Android app market, while Google claimed the trial process was flawed. The decision could affect competition dynamics between Google and rival platforms.

US Supreme Court snubs Epic Games legal battle with Apple
Economic Times
·
1y ago
Medial
The U.S. Supreme Court has rejected Epic Games' antitrust challenge against Apple's App Store policies. This decision is a setback for Epic Games in their ongoing legal battle with the iPhone maker. The court refused to hear Epic's appeal and also declined to hear Apple's appeal of a lower court's decision that restricted certain App Store rules.

Epic Games settles lawsuit against Samsung over app controls - The Economic Times
Economic Times
·
29d ago
Medial
Epic Games settled its antitrust claims against Samsung, accusing it of conspiring with Google to limit competition to Google Play. The settlement terms are undisclosed, but Epic’s CEO, Tim Sweeney, expressed gratitude for Samsung addressing their concerns. Epic's claims against Google continue, focusing on mobile security features allegedly deterring alternative app downloads. Google's appeal in a separate verdict favoring Epic, which requires app store overhauls, is ongoing. The settlement dismisses Epic's claims against Samsung.
